NASA Form 1735, (Request, Authorization, Agreement and Certification of Training) is used by learners at the centers to submit a request for external training. The form is submitted through SATERN (System Administration for Training and Educational Resources for NASA) on the learner’s side for approval.Since July 2006 the NSSC has been tasked with processing external training.Presently processed over 20,000 requests.All external training can be identified in SATERN by the course ID. If Non-Academic, <EX><Vendor acronym><course acronym> ex. EX-USDA-FFMC ( for Federal Financial Management Conference). If Academic, <EX><AC><vendor acronym><course# or catalog ID> ex. EX-AC-BU-CS237 (for CS237: Interdisciplinary Scientific Visualization)

Once submitted, there is a four step approval process: Supervisor, Training Coordinator, Training Office, and NSSCYou will receive e-mail notifications at each step in the approval chain. To be aware of the ongoing status of your request:• Select LEARNING from the main menu on the home page• Select EXTERNAL TRAINING REQUESTS from the submenu• Click on the REQUEST ID of the training request you wish to

view• Scroll to the end of page to view the status of each step in the

approval chain• Upon final approval, the external training request will be added

to your learning planNote: The form will go to the designated supervisor in SATERN. Once you submit the form and change supervisor, the form will not go the new supervisor unless you resubmit the form.

Non-Academic training• One week after completion, learner will receive a mandatory

certification request via email.• After one week, if no response, learner will receive a reminder

before the link expires.• Learner will have two weeks to complete certification.

Academic Training• Upon completion, learner will receive an email requesting

transcript or screen shot of their grade(s).

NOTE: Please make sure the screenshot has the actual grade showing.

Responses for Non-Academic and Academic Training are required before completion is granted.

Since July 2007 the NSSC has been tasked with processing internal trainingTraining that require an instructor at one of the NASA centers, onsite trainingCenter Training Office submits Internal Training Request form and Internal Training Procurement Requisition form to NSSC via fax using Form 27 as a cover sheetPresently processed over 570 requests.All internal training can be identified in SATERN by the center domain and course acronym. Ex. SSC-COTR or as identified on ITRF

• The Consolidated Appropriations Act of 2008, which was enacted last year, included language that limits the number of government employees participating in conferences outside the United States. According to the Act: "None of the funds made available in this Act may be used to send or otherwise pay for the attendance of more than 50 employees from a Federal department or agency at any single conference occurring outside the United States."
